Output ed4fac76a3248d841afe822ece77fbb2a873dfad50570c428d087121b0f0bb83:0

value
13416533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573075a4c3aa18b839670aea8b9e84e6a908fc5a OP_EQUAL
address
39e2mG74cbodvpMxrBMPcvrX8aFZEE7kTV
transaction
ed4fac76a3248d841afe822ece77fbb2a873dfad50570c428d087121b0f0bb83
spent
true